Lebam and Tokeland are places in Washington.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Lebam has the higher population (343 vs 99 in Tokeland). Tokeland has the higher median household income ($54,844 vs $42,917 in Lebam). Tokeland has the higher median home value ($167,200 vs $155,200 in Lebam).
